📅 Monthly Projects
Each month, your child will complete a fun and educational website project:
-
My Personal Blog
Design a blog layout and write weekly posts about hobbies, opinions, or tech topics — great for learning structure and content formatting. -
Startup Landing Page
Create a mock landing page for a fictional startup idea — practice layout, branding, and persuasive writing. -
Tech News & Reviews Hub
Build a mini news site featuring latest gadgets, apps, or games — with categories, review cards, and styled article blocks. -
Online Portfolio
Create a professional-style portfolio to showcase their coding, design, or creative work. Include sections like “About Me,” “Projects,” and “Contact.” -
Event Promotion Page
Design a site for a pretend event — a music festival, charity run, or gaming tournament — including schedule, guest list, and RSVP form layout. -
World Explorer Journal
Build a digital travel journal about different countries, including interactive maps, cultural facts, and travel bucket list items. -
Fictional Business Site
Invent and build a small business website — like a bakery, fashion brand, or sports club — with homepage, product/services, and contact pages. -
Passion Project Showcase
Create a site dedicated to a personal passion (e.g., robotics, art, chess, photography) with photo galleries, stories, and tutorials. -
Timeline of Technology
Design an educational timeline-style site that highlights major milestones in tech history — each event with a short description and image. -
Student Newspaper Site
Build a site for a fictional school newspaper with articles, categories, and a featured article section.
